Aged care resources

A list of resources – including apps, audio and video resources and other publications – about aged care.

My Aged Care has resources that the aged care sector can order to share with their clients. This includes brochures, booklets and checklists. These resources are also available in up to 22 other languages.

Care finder policy guidance for PHNs

The care finder policy guidance provides advice to Primary Health Networks (PHNs) on expectations regarding implementation and delivery of the care finder program.

ISCOA Project Pilot Evaluation Informing Future Policy

This report draws on findings and lessons learned through the Australian Government funded evaluation of the Improving Social Connectedness of Older Australians This report will help future models of care and interventions for lonely and socially isolated older Australians.

Food and Nutrition Report

This report provides an analysis of the data collected by the department from residential services through the Food and Nutrition report. It details key next steps on how the data will be utilised to help inform policy options to further improve food and nutrition outcomes for older Australians.

National Obesity Strategy 2022–2032

The National Obesity Strategy is a 10-year framework for action to prevent, reduce, and treat, overweight and obesity in Australia. It focuses on prevention, but also includes actions to better support Australians who are living with overweight or obesity, to live their healthiest lives.

Application for bed-ready residential care places form

This application form should be used by approved provider organisations, approved to provide residential aged care, who are seeking an allocation of new residential care places in respect of a service that is in a position to provide care (‘bed-ready’).
